The Swans are set to capture former Derby County left back Lee Buchanan as Michael Duff continues to build his squad ahead of the new season. Buchanan, who has spent the last twelve months at Werder Bremen, will sign on to join other new permanent additions to the Swansea City squad in Josh Ginnelly,...
